School of Law, Walailak University organised the “Personality Development Programme for Lawyers” on Wednesday 15 March 2023, from 1:00 PM to 4:00 PM, at Building 7, Room 07217, Walailak University. The objective is to enhance and develop the personality of the students of the School of Laws and to make them disciplined and able to express themselves in the right way when they stand in front of many people.

Miss Amonrat Ammaratsena, Head of the Research Institute of the School of Law and Miss Sinittha Dittapan, Head of Law Department attend an academic conference on the occasion of the 25th anniversary of the establishment of the Constitutional Court of the Kingdom of Thailand at the Chatrium Hotel Riverside Bangkok within the event which consists of a special speech “Protection of rights and liberties of the people according to the Constitution of the Kingdom of Thailand” by Mr.Chuan Leekpai
Special Lecture on “The Constitutional Court on the Protection of the People’s Rights and Liberties” by the President of the Constitutional Court of the Kingdom of Thailand, President of the Constitutional Court of the Republic of Korea, President of the Constitutional Court of Mongolia, President of the Constitutional Court of the Republic of Indonesia, and Secretary of the Office of the Constitutional Court of the Republic of Austria in an academic conference on the topic of “The Constitutional Court on the Protection of People’s Rights and Liberties” by a qualified speaker, Dr. Punya Udchachon as a judge of the Constitutional Court, Prof. Charan Pakdeethanakul, Emeritus Professor Dr. Borwornsak Uwanno, Professor Dr. Banjerd Singkaneti, moderated by Mr. Boonserm Naksarn, Deputy Secretary-General of the Office of the Constitutional Court.

Associate Professor Doctor Charun Bunyakan, Acting Dean of the School of Law and Assistant Professor Doctor Wijittra Petchkit, Acting Vice Dean of the School of Law, lecturers, staff, and students of the School of Law participated in the Walailak Songkran Festival 2023 at the Architecture and Design (AD) Building Walailak University. Water-pouring ceremony to seek adult blessings for prosperity. There are also food kiosks from various agencies available, and the School of Law has arranged herbal drinking kiosks for attendees.

School of Law, Walailak University organised a project “Guidelines for writing answers to legal questions when being a law student and guidance from experienced speakers and seniors” in the legal writing course on 25 March 2023, to promote writing skills for legal exams and entertain to build human relations for first year students.
In such activities, lecturers and second & third year senior students participated in organising a legal writing workshop for first year students to develop writing, which is an important skill for studying law and taking care of students academically for the best of preparing the final examination of the academic year 3/2022 on 3-10 April 2023.
